Eastern edge of Mound E 50

A large number of seals and inscribed objects were discovered in excavations on the eastern edge of Mound E from 1993 to 1997. This view of excavations in Trench 10W shows two rooms of houses along the edge of a north-south street. A square steatite seal was found in the dust bin in the center of the photograph and numerous incised and molded tablets were found in the overlying debris. These deposits date to Period 3B of the Harappa Phase, circa 2450-2200 BCE.
